Nigeria Lacks Good Leaders, Says Davido

On the 'Elevate Africa Convos' podcast, Davido stated that Nigeria can thrive but suffers from poor government, which impedes advancement.

Afrobeats artist David Adeleke, better known as Davido, has declared that competent leadership is the critical missing component for Nigeria to fulfill its full potential.

On the ‘Elevate Africa Convos’ podcast, Davido stated that Nigeria can thrive but suffers from poor government, which impedes advancement.

“I tell people, if you can survive in Nigeria, you can survive anywhere,” Davido stated.

“I just feel the only thing missing is the right leaders to guide us. Once we get that right, I believe there’s nothing that can stop us.”

Daily Sun recalls that Davido recently created controversy by advising Americans against considering relocating to Africa, particularly Nigeria, claiming the country’s economy is in “shambles” in a podcast interview.

In another interview with The Morning Hustle podcast, Davido stated that Nigeria lacked real democracy.
